Frequently Asked Questions
What is a spider bulb?
The spider design spreads the SMD LEDs outward for a 180-degree viewing angle, producing more even light than a flat panel bulb.
Do I need a load equalizer?
Only for turn signal use. Add an ORACLE Load Equalizer (50W / 6 Ohm) to prevent rapid-flash. It is not required for brake, reverse, or running light applications.
